Repair Procedures: Removal

  1. Release the residual pressure in fuel line (Refer to "RELEASE RESIDUAL PRESSURE IN FUEL LINE ").
  2. Remove the rear seat cushion (Refer to REPLACEMENT ).
  3. Remove the fuel pump service cover (A).
    Fig 1: Fuel Pump Service Cover
    G10234590Courtesy of HYUNDAI MOTOR AMERICA
  4. Disconnect the fuel pump connector (A) and the fuel tank pressure sensor connector (B).
  5. Disconnect the fuel feed tube quick connector (C).
    Fig 2: Fuel Pump, Fuel Tank Pressure Sensor Connectors And Fuel Feed Tube Quick Connector
    G10234591Courtesy of HYUNDAI MOTOR AMERICA
  6. Remove the rear - LH wheel & tire.
  7. Lift the vehicle and support the fuel tank with a jack.
  8. Remove the center muffler assembly (Refer to REMOVAL AND INSTALLATION ).
  9. Disconnect the fuel filler hose (A).
    Fig 3: Fuel Filler Hose
    G10234592Courtesy of HYUNDAI MOTOR AMERICA
  10. Remove the under cover (A) and the parking brake line (B).
    Fig 4: Vehicle Under Cover And Parking Brake Line
    G10234593Courtesy of HYUNDAI MOTOR AMERICA
  11. Disconnect the vapor tube quick-connector (A).
  12. Remove the fuel tank from the vehicle after removing the fuel tank band (B).
    Fig 5: Vapor Tube Quick-Connector And Fuel Tank Band
    G10234594Courtesy of HYUNDAI MOTOR AMERICA
    NOTE: When removing the fuel tank, the fuel tank must be tilted because of interfering with coupling.
